I've been loosing my hair since the age of 18. Went on rogaine and kept it at a minimum. But I still had a receding hair line and wished to fix it.
Last year I contacted Dr. Marwan Saifi from AM-MED in Wroclaw, Poland, and he convinced me that a FUT would be good. I did mention the concern I had with the scar, as I like my hair short on the sides and the back, but he mentioned that it should't be a problem and attached 2 pictures of really good looking scars.
First of all. Dr. Saifi personally replies to every e-mail. Everything is very professional. You get picked up personally by a driver and driven to the hotel. Really nice hotel. The day after you get to the clinic and as they only do 1 patient a day, you are really taken care of. There's nothing to say about that. Top quality.
However. 2 major points would make me not recommend this clinic.
- First of all the scar IS a big issue, when you want short hair in the back. The 2 pictures he attached perhaps reflect the 2 best outcomes, but my outcome was not that good, and now I need to have a hair cut at least 15 mm on the back to cover the scar (usually I had 6 mm).
- Second of all. He didn't ask me 1 single time what my goals were with the transplantion. He didn't drew my new hair line. Didn't ask me what concerned me. Nothing. This was my first hair transplant, so I didn't question anything. The results are now, that yes my hairline did improve slightly but I still had a pretty bad hair line.
Price: 8 zloty pr. graft therefore 12000 zloty for 1500 grafts.
Now, after a lot of research, I've decided to get my next HT - this time a FUE done by Dr. Ilkay Apaydin from Istanbul. I got it done yesterday, so results are not in yet.
2500 grafts were approximately transfered including covering the scar.
This has also been very professional from the get-go. Pick-up, hotel amazing and everything professional. Although it isn't the doctor who replies to e-mails but a girl who speaks good english.
Only bad experience so far was the communication or the lack of.
- I mentioned explicitly that I wanted the FUT scar covered along with the hair line. I got an reply that this was doable.
Then, when I met the doctor. The first he said was that we couldn't do both the FUT scar and the hairline in the same procedure. Had I known this, I wouldn't have chosen that clinic. I felt extremely bad, but luckily I insisted and agreed to the possible loosing of grafts at the FUT scar as you usually sleep on your back.
- I asked, was if I could keep my hair long on top, as I would like to hide it as much as possible. This was again, not a problem. Although when I came to the clinic, the lady who shaves almost shaved off all of my hair. Luckely I managed to stop her.
- I asked if I could get a 6 mm hair cut on the sides and back just to keep the difference in check, so I don't have a completely shaven head on the back and 2 cm of hair on the sides but rather 6 mm. I was advised against this, as they would shave it at the clinic. Guess what, they only shaved the back even though I asked for the sides as well. So now I look completely retarded.
A very good experience except that, and the results look promising. I'll update as time goes.
Price; 1850 euros everything included.
